Hi Margaret......I remember the small Vim*o bottles with the metal tops on that flipped off. I remember we used to collect and swap the different kinds of bottle tops at school. Remember the waxed straws in the school milk bottles, how they went soggy and collapsed before you'd drunk all your milk!! Same with the Ki*ra drink cartons in the cinema.lol We are so used to having plastic ones now I'd forgotten what a pain those straws were.. |

I don't remember Orange Powder Margaret, but I certainly remember Lemon Powder, I remember my fingers being all yellowy, as you had to suck the powder off them out of a paper bag, yuk, sounds disgusting,but I loved it and so did all my yucky little friends!! The thing was it was SO cheap to buy, so were Sherbert Fountains; you sucked the sherbert through a liquorice straw, and if you did it wrong it made you splutter and cough. Remember Gobstoppers changing colour as they got smaller, all cheap as cheap!
